Output d7533fbc5e609d94d2bae4e496b64b3a71c19aca00ca808463961c83dbc865fe:3

value
26951400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617091b068dc0ce9d805d58f7d99ed776e442819 OP_EQUAL
address
3AaEKb8r46429rCrsQhcKTuyfn1gSCiRjG
transaction
d7533fbc5e609d94d2bae4e496b64b3a71c19aca00ca808463961c83dbc865fe
confirmations
299778
spent
true